Mesothelioma Attorneys

A mesothelioma attorney can help you make an asbestos trust fund claim, a personal injury lawsuit or a wrongful death lawsuit. They will also work to discover which asbestos companies are responsible for your exposure.

Due to the lengthy latency period of mesothelioma, it can be difficult to remember the date or where you were exposed. A mesothelioma lawyer will utilize special resources to determine the details.

Cases that go to trial

Mesothelioma lawsuits can be complicated. However, a majority of cases are settled before trial. If the case goes to trial, a jury will decide what amount of compensation the victim is entitled to. The verdict of a trial may be appealed. This could delay the payment of compensation by months or even years.

In the United States, the majority of mesothelioma lawsuits are filed by personal injury lawyers. They seek financial compensation for victims' medical bills as well as lost wages and other. The money from a mesothelioma lawsuit will not bring back health or a loved one. However, it can help the victims family members and the legal system get the best possible treatment.

The discovery phase of a mesothelioma case can be prolonged for months as lawyers compile evidence and witnesses. A mesothelioma attorney will interview former and current workers who might have valuable information on asbestos exposure. The lawyer will also gather medical documents to prove that exposure to asbestos led to a mesothelioma-related diagnosis. A client may be required to give an interview during this phase of the process. This can be recorded and played for the jury should the case go to trial.

Wrongful death lawsuits seek compensation for the loss of a family member due to mesothelioma, or another asbestos-related illness. These lawsuits seek justice by holding responsible parties accountable for negligently exposing victims to asbestos. These lawsuits are filed by the spouses, children, or other dependents who have lost loved ones.

Compensation

Asbestos attorneys can aid mesothelioma patients and their families in making compensation claims. Compensation can assist victims in covering expenses for medical treatment or lost wages, as well as other financial obligations. It may also be used to pay for travel expenses if a victim requires a visit to an expert who is far away from their home.

A mesothelioma attorney can assist victims in determining the amount of compensation they are entitled to receive. Compensation for a mesothelioma case could include punitive, non-economic and economic damages. Economic damages can include payments for past and future medical expenses, lost wages and funeral expenses. Non-economic damages may include pain and discomfort as well as loss of consortium and emotional distress. Punitive damages are a form of punishment that seeks to stop asbestos companies from engaging in unlawful or oppressive practices, or committing grossly negligent behavior.

In addition, mesothelioma lawyers can assist victims and their families in filing wrongful death lawsuits. The wrongful death claims are similar to personal injury lawsuits and seek compensation for the loss of loved ones due to exposure to asbestos. These claims can be made by the spouses, children or other family members who were close to asbestos victims.
